Zell am See to Salzburg by train
The journey from Zell am See to Salzburg by train is 55.98 km and takes 1 hr 58 mins. There are 6 connections per day, with the first departure at 04:51 and the last at 19:47. It is possible to travel from Zell am See to Salzburg by train for as little as âŹ15.00 or as much as âŹ18.00. The best price for this journey is âŹ15.00.

Which stations can I use on the Zell am See to Salzburg route?
In Zell am See, departure stations include SchĂŒttdorf Areitbahn,Zellermoos Bahnhst,Zell am See ZOB. When you arrive in Salzburg, you may be able to disembark at stations such as Salzburg Airport,Salzburg Gnigl Bahnhof,Salzburg Hbf,Salzburg South. ĂBB stands for Ăsterreichische Bundesbahnen, which is the Austrian Federal Railways. ĂBB operates passenger train services throughout Austria and beyond, with connections to neighboring countries such as Germany, Switzerland, Italy, and the Czech Republic. ĂBB is known for its high-quality service, modern trains, and an extensive rail network.
ĂBB Railjet is a high-speed train service operated by the Austrian Federal Railways (ĂBB). It connects major Austrian cities to locations in Hungary, Germany, Switzerland, and the Czech Republic. Ticket types and facilities from Zell am See to Salzburg
Compare the different ticket types and the facilities provided by Railjet when traveling from Zell am See to Salzburg.
Economy Class
Economy class offers open-plan seating with power sockets and luggage racks.First Class
First class features reclining leather seats, tables, power sockets, and the option to order food and drinks.Business Class
Business class offers even more comfortable seating, a complimentary welcome drink, and the ability to order food and drinks from the restaurant menu, but it's only available on select routes and for an additional fee.Facility Description
